Indications have emerged that the Minister of Solid Minerals, Dr. Kayode Fayemi may have stepped up plans to return to the Ekiti State Government House.We gathered that the former governor foot soldiers have begun underground moves by reviving abandoned political structures used during his first term and his failed re-election bid.
It was also gathered that trailer loads of food items meant to be distributed during Sallah were sighted in some Ekiti towns, a move said to be designed to launch the return bid of the Iyin Ekiti born Federal Minister. It would be recalled that the former governor lost his bid to be elected for a second term. Few days ago, Civil servants, students and artisans among others were also seen scrambling to have a share of food items such as rice, spaghetti, indomie, salt, sugar and condiments the former governor said he distributed in order to “prevent hunger and starvation”.
The former governor is said to be banking on the clampdown launched against the incumbent governor of the state, Ayo Fayose and his close associates by the anti-graft agency, the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C). It is believed that this will reduce the level of support the governor seems to be enjoying from the masses in the state.
Series of protest have been organized in the state recently with the latest on Thursday where a horde of placard-carrying protesters that comprised of party leaders in Fayemi’s All Progressives Congress, students, youth groups, artisans and other residents marched from the popular Adekunle Fajuyi park through Okeyinmi to Ijigbo Round-About describing the recent freezing of the personal accounts of Gov. Fayose in Zenith Bank as proper.
Party sources confided that series of protests have been lined up to show the decreasing level of acceptability of Governor Fayose. “though Fayemi has not informed anyone of us of his ambition but we have been seeing subtle moves from his people. He has been showing actions in the party affairs unlike before and we think that is suggestive”, the party source.
It would be recalled that Governor Ayo Fayose defeated then incumbent, Dr Fayemi in the government election held in Ekiti state in June 2014, stopping the governor from ruling for another four year term.
